Ícono del sitio La Neta Neta

Dropbase puede ayudar a convertir su hoja de cálculo desordenada en una base de datos SQL consultable

Dropbase puede ayudar a convertir su hoja de cálculo desordenada en una base de datos SQL consultable

No es raro que una empresa de tecnología nazca por accidente. Famosamente, Slack se creó como un subproducto de una empresa de juegos ahora desaparecida. De manera similar, cuando los fundadores de Dropbase Jimmy Chan y Ayazhan Zhakhan estaban en el Lote Y Combinator Winter 20estaban probando el producto que habían construido en ese momento y accidentalmente tropezaron con lo que se convertiría Base desplegable.

Los dos fundadores luchaban por mover los datos de la hoja de cálculo a una base de datos SQL donde pudieran trabajar con ellos. A pesar de que eran personas técnicas, no podían hacer que todo funcionara sin muchos retoques. Crearon una herramienta para facilitar arrastrar y soltar un archivo .csv en una base de datos de Postgres y comenzar a consultarlo.

Chan dice que fue una especie de momento eureka para ellos, ya que se dieron cuenta de que si tenían problemas para hacer esto, muchas otras personas también los tendrían, y cambiaron de marcha para crear Dropbase.

“Estábamos pensando que debería haber una manera más fácil de hacerlo. Solo quiero arrastrar y soltar un archivo .csv directamente en una base de datos SQL. Y fue entonces cuando se nos ocurrió el nombre Dropbase, porque puede arrastrarlo a una base de datos de Postgres, y solo le damos las credenciales para la base de datos, por lo que tendría acceso instantáneo a ese archivo .csv en su base de datos alojada en la nube. Así es como empezamos con esto”, dijo Chan a TechCrunch.

Tuvieron que superar algunos obstáculos importantes con los que cualquiera que trabaje con datos estaría familiarizado, como reconciliar diferencias en los mismos datos que pueden confundir un filtro de conversión. “Después de arrastrar y soltar un archivo .csv, por lo general todavía hay muchos problemas con el archivo. A veces, diferentes partes del mundo codifican los archivos .csv de manera diferente. Por ejemplo, en Francia, usan puntos y comas en lugar de comas. Y así, en primer lugar, hacemos inferencia. Miramos una muestra de los datos y tratamos de adivinar cuál es la mejor manera de abrir el archivo”, dijo.

Dijo que otro problema es que los datos no siempre están en el formato que espera que estén en la tabla, entonces, ¿cómo logra que sean consistentes? Se les ocurrió la noción de verificaciones para asegurarse de que los datos estén en el formato correcto para pasar los filtros de conversión, pero Chan dice que van más allá de las simples verificaciones sintácticas.

Créditos de imagen: Base desplegable

“En realidad son verificaciones semánticas. Entonces, lo que quiero decir con eso es que no solo estamos verificando si su código postal tiene un formato determinado, sino que podemos verificar si sus fechas están dentro de un rango determinado, o si son posteriores a una hora determinada o anteriores a una hora determinada. , o si sus números deben ser un mínimo de algo. Entonces es un poco más [sophisticated] revisando”, explicó.

Él dice que una vez que le muestran al usuario los problemas, pueden limpiar cualquier problema restante y luego cargar la base de datos y está disponible para consultar en SQL. “La ventaja de tener datos en una base de datos SQL es que puedes consultarlos rápidamente. Eso es lo primero. Lo segundo es que puede conectarlo a una herramienta posterior como una herramienta de BI u otra herramienta de datos de una manera más fácil. Y puede crear más conjuntos de datos históricos con el tiempo”, dijo.

Las características más recientes del producto incluyen una nueva herramienta llamada Dropmail, que permite a los usuarios enviar por correo electrónico un archivo .csv para convertirlo en una base de datos SQL, y la capacidad de alojar sus propios datos con la integración de Snowflake.

La empresa ha recaudado una ronda inicial de 1,75 millones de dólares hasta ahora dirigida por Gradient Ventures de Google, con la participación de YC y otros.


Source link
Salir de la versión móvil